ETCHE LGA CHAIRMAN, HON. CHIMA NJOKU, ANNOUNCES FIRST SET OF APPOINTMENTS AND SPECIAL COMMITTEES

The Chairman of Etche Local Government Area, Chief. Hon. Chima Boniface Njoku, has approved the appointment of the following persons into key positions in his administration, with immediate effect.

They are;

• Chief of Staff – Hezekiah Williams

• Legal Adviser – Barr. Blessing Amanze

  • Chief Security Cordinator – CSP. Anthony Offuna (Rtd)
  • ⁠Chief Security Adviser – DSP. Enyio Felix Enyio (Rtd)
  • Director of Communications, Creative Industry & Strategy – Robinson Oluor • Chief Press Secretary – Dagogo Isaac • Assistant Press Secretary – Anyanwu ThankGod (Ocean) • Executive Assistant on Media & Publicity – Temple Okere • Chief Protocol Officer – Moses Iroegbu • Protocol Officer 2 – Emeka Nwanoro • Protocol Officer 3 – Samuel Ejimozuo • Protocol Officer 4 – Timothy Chidebe Onyeche • Personal Assistant – Osinachi Gift Amajirionwu • Chief Detail – Hope Onyeche • Special Assistant on Domestic Matters – Aaron Brown • Confidential Secretary – Cyril Onwudebe

SENIOR SPECIAL ASSISTANTS

• SSA on Electronic Media I – Ugochukwu Eke

• SSA on Electronic Media II – Nnodim Endurance Obinachi

• SSA on Electronic Media III – Dick Alexander

• SSA on New Media I – Nwanyanwu Kingsley Chibuzor

• SSA on New Media II – Nwoko Ugochukwu

• SSA on New Media III – Lawrence Ikedichi Anaebo

TASK-FORCE COMMITTEE ON LAND GRABBING

• Chairman – Chief. Emma Nwaobilor

• Secretary – Barr. Jerome Okere

• Spokesperson – Hon. Mrs. Uche Ken Ndukwu

• Member – Stanley Amaechi

• Member – Chief Ugochukwu Onyegbu

AD-HOC COMMITTEE ON DREDGING

• Chairman – Ikechi Nwogu

• Secretary – Reginald Onwuka

• Member – High Chief Umeh Adiele

• Member – Teslin Agbagbuo

• Member – Barr. Ndimele Chijioke Prince

• Member – Barr. John Anyanwu

• Member – Engr. Godpower Nwaekeala

The Ad-hoc Committee on Dredging has been specifically tasked to investigate the damages caused by dredging activities across Etche Local Government Area and to report back to the Chairman within two (2) weeks.

Hon. Chima Njoku urged all appointees to see their new responsibilities as a call to selfless service, dedication, and commitment to the progress of Etche. He expressed confidence that the team will work with him to deliver the dividends of democracy to the people across all communities.

Signed
Chief. Hon. Chima Boniface Njoku,
Chairman,
Etche Local Government Area.
2nd September, 2025.
